# Seat-map renderer for the Pellindrome Theatre app.
#
# Heads up for review: the renderer lays out seats on a curved
# grid, so row spacing isn't uniform — the arc factor compensates
# for the balcony's tighter curve. Don't be tempted to merge the
# stalls and balcony paths; they diverge on aisle handling and it
# gets ugly fast. Zoom limits exist because past a point the seat
# labels collide and box office staff complain. The geometry and
# zoom constants are set below.

tuning constants:
QUOTAS = {
    "druwyn": 5,
    "holix": 5,
    "zorath": 5,
    "holwyn": 10,
}

Handover: flaky DNS in Copperfen gateway

Hey — passing this one to you mid-investigation. The Copperfen gateway intermittently fails to resolve the upstream billing host, maybe twice an hour, always recovering on retry. I suspect the resolver cache TTL is fighting with the mesh's short-lived records. I bumped retry counts and added negative-cache suppression, which helped but didn't eliminate it. My patch is up for your review, and it changes the resolver settings to the following values.

service settings:
PRAIX_LOG_LEVEL=error
PRAIX_METRICS_HOST=metrics.praix.qorvelcorp.corp
PRAIX_POOL_SIZE=16

TO: Dispatch Desk
SUBJECT: Replacement server — Corvale branch

Replacement server unit for the Corvale branch office is packed and ready at the Westhollow IT bay. One flight case, padded, approx. 28 kg. Needs to go on tomorrow's first run; branch is down until it arrives. Driver must keep it upright and avoid stacking. Sign-out required at the bay. The confidential hand-over instruction for the courier is given below.

courier memo of tawep-tajep: the quenius ulaiel courier leaves the fenir ledger at gate 9128 under passcode 527513

Action item from the Orlin Pipeline incident: the shrinkbat CLI silently skipped images over 40MB during batch resizing, producing incomplete galleries without any error code. We need a patch that emits a non-zero exit status and a per-file skip report. Reviewers should check that the new flag parsing doesn't break existing cron invocations at Pellworth Studios. The proposed diff and test plan are documented on the internal page.

wiki page, tahaf-tajog: https://jira.ordindyn.corp/pipeline